MANILA, Philippines — Creamline will try to dig deep from its reserves as it looks to reclaim the solo lead against Farm Fresh today in the Premier Volleyball League All-Filipino Conference at the Filoil EcoOil Arena.

The Cool Smashers had the luxury of resting their starters after their second unit headed by Pau Soriano and Lorie Bernardo stepped up in a 25-15, 25-12, 25-10 rout of the Gerflor Defenders Thursday in Antipolo City

It catapulted the multi-titled franchise to its third straight triumph and into the lead before Petro Gazz caught up with Creamline after turning back a feisty Nxled, 25-23, 25-21, 25-22, in an out-of-town sortie in Candon, Ilocos Sur Saturday.

And the Cool Smashers have a chance to jump back to a familiar place – the top.

“Usual ginagawa namin pinag hahandaan namin any team, kahit sino makalaban kailangan talaga paghandaan,” said Creamline coach Sherwin Meneses of their 4 p.m. duel with the Foxies, winless in four starts.

Soriano and Bernardo came through when Meneses pulled them like rabbits from a magic hat and readily delivered by combining for 10 points while also providing the rock-solid net defense.

Also part of the heavy three-game offering are matches pitting Chery Tiggo (2-1) against Gerflor (0-3) at 2 p.m. and Cignal (1-2) versus a giant-slaying Akari (3-1) at 6 p.m.
